Resurfacing underway on SR 136 in Dawson, Hall counties

GAINESVILLE - Crews are working to resurface a 10-mile stretch of road on State Route 136 (Price Road) from State Route 400 in Dawson County to State Route 60 (Thompson Bridge Road) in Hall County.

Teri Pope with the Georgia Department of Transportation said work will take place week days from 8:30 a.m. to 4:30 p.m.

In addition to resurfacing the roadway, crews are adding two-foot wide paved shoulders.

"This is a great safety feature," Pope said, "Because when you run out of the road it gives you a paved surface and room to recover so you can get back in the road safely."

Pope said to be on the lookout for the DOT's pilot car, which will lead drivers through the work zone.

"Know that if you're traveling 136 you could be stopped and you'll have to wait a few minutes for that pilot car," she said.

The $1.8 million project is expected to be finished in November, but Pope said it might be done sooner if the warm weather holds up.
